Birthdate
December 1977
Nationality
Uk
Occupations
Director
Roles
Director
Address
Flat 10, Lake House, Scovell Road, London, England, SE1 1QF
William Leuchars was born in December 1977.
William Leuchars Business Events
05 May 2016
Appointment
NEWSIE LIMITED
William Leuchars was appointed a director
at 39 years old.
Uk